PURPLE CABBAGE AND PANEER COLESLAW
In this Indian twist to the world famous coleslaw, crispy and vibrant purple cabbage is tossed along with some carrots, apples, marinated paneer and a creamy dressing made with mayonnaise and cider vinegar.

KUZHI PANIYARAM/PADDU/GOLIAPPA/YERIAPPA is a spherical-shaped classic South-Indian Tiffin item that is typically made using leftover idli or dosa batter and cooked in a “Paniyaram pan”, a griddle with several concave dents or Kuzhis (holes).
